The long-awaited 2023 Guinness Ghana DJ Awards has just kicked off at the Grand Arena.
The Black Carpet of the 11th edition came with eye-gripping styles as fashion gurus delivered as expected.

Fashion King, Osibo The Zaara Man, among other hosts of fashion enthusiasts, graced the Black Carpet with amazing costumes.







Organised by Merqury Republic, the stage will come alive with the musical prowess of Ghanaian reggae sensation Stonebwoy, the chart-topping Monica hit-maker Kuami Eugene, and the dynamic DJ Vyrusky.
Joining them will be the likes of DJ Sly King, DJ Faculty, DJ Lord OTB, DJ Nyce Samini, DJSKY, and the sensational DJ Polly Esther, flying in all the way from the Netherlands.
One of the highlights in anticipation of the evening is the announcement of the DJ of the Year. With the competition reaching new heights each year, the question on everyone's mind is, who will clinch the prestigious title this time?
The Guinness Ghana DJ Awards is powered by Smirnoff and sponsored by Game Park Games, Virtual Sound Lab, Uniduscondoms, DSTV Akwaaba Magic, PC Entertainment, and Hooked On Entertainment.
